JOB SUMMARYSupervise all bus drivers and bus assistants. Ensure all routes and trips are completed on-time with available resources. Review GPS reports and onboard video cameras. Enforce progressive discipline as needed. Complete employee evaluations. Administer the student management program. Represent the district at meetings, conferences, and seminars in a professional manner. Required to obtain a Class B CDL License with P and S endorsements, and transport students to and from school.

Job Task Descriptions- 1. Supervise, assign work to ensure coverage, and evaluate all assigned bus drivers and bus assistants. Provide work direction, identify and resolve transportation issues, schedule retraining, and problem-solve route and personnel issues. Provide customer service to our transportation employees. Enforce progressive discipline as needed and complete employee evaluations. Administer the student management program. Initiate protocols to ensure students are being transported safely to and from school.
Monitor all aspects of bus driver and bus assistant performance, including spot checking for pre-trips, and post-trips, appropriate use of specialized equipment, and driving ability. Respond to accident scenes, assess damage and injuries, and implement reasonable suspicion protocols when deemed necessary. Follow all accident protocols. Transport students to and from school daily.
Daily – 50% - 2. Monitor ongoing two-way radio and telephone communications with transportation, district security, dispatch, and school personnel as required. Meet with transportation employees, students, parents/guardians, school employees, and district administrators, to review onboard video.
Daily – 25% - 3. Use specialized software programs to compile department forms, detailed maps, graphic and other operational paperwork. Utilize GPS tracking system, and vehicle computerized tablets for turn by turn directions.
Daily – 10% - 4. Implement emergency procedures (e.g. snow days, accidents, early school closure, emergency closures) when necessary. Share in after hours, weekend and holiday on-call responsibilities.
Daily – 5% - 5. Represent the district at meetings, conferences, and seminars in a professional manner. Meet with personnel within other transportation departments within the state for problem solving, coordination, and implementation of new rules and regulations. Attend in-district bus driver meetings at schools and represent bus driver and bus assistant interests and concerns.
